Easy hiking trails around North Cave are primarily found within the North Cave Wetlands Nature Reserve, an area transformed from a former sand and gravel quarry into a thriving ecosystem. The landscape features diverse wetlands, including shallow and deep-water lakes, reedbeds, and grassy banks, providing a habitat for varied wildlife. The terrain is generally flat, offering accessible paths suitable for easy walking. This region is characterized by its successful ecological restoration and well-maintained, accessible trails.

April 13, 2025, All Saints Church, North Cave

All Saints is a beautiful Grade I listed medieval church built and modified from the thirteenth century onwards, with a few remaining Norman features. Its chief glory is the magnificent East Window by Dr Douglas Strachan, who also designed much of the glass in the neighbouring church of St Oswald in Hotham. Useful village car park just south of the church next to a playground, ideal starting point for circular walks. https://historicengland.org.uk/listing/the-list/list-entry/1203419, https://www.northcave-pc.gov.uk/our-community/north-cave-church/

Managed by the Yorkshire Wildlife Trust, North Cave Wetlands nature reserve used to be a sand and gravel quarry. It's been rejuvenated in the 21st century and is now a haven for waterbirds and insects. Look out for Avocets, Common Terns and dragonfly.

Are there any wheelchair-accessible easy walks in North Cave?

The North Cave Wetlands Nature Reserve is known for its accessibility. It features mainly stone and grass paths that are flat and suitable for wheelchairs and pushchairs, especially the main circular footpath. Stone paths remain accessible year-round, though grass paths can become muddy in winter.

What is the best time of year to visit North Cave for easy hikes?

North Cave offers enjoyable easy hikes year-round. Spring and summer are excellent for wildlife spotting, with many birds returning and butterflies thriving. Autumn provides beautiful colours, and winter offers a chance to see wintering wildfowl. Stone paths are accessible all year, but grass paths can be muddy in colder, wetter months.

What kind of wildlife can I expect to see on the easy trails in North Cave?

The North Cave Wetlands Nature Reserve is rich in wildlife. You can expect to see a wide variety of birds, including wintering wildfowl, waders, avocets, and oystercatchers. Butterflies, dragonflies, and damselflies are common on grassy banks, and you might even spot water voles. Strategically placed hides offer excellent viewing opportunities.
